The economy of CALABARZON contracted by 10.5 percent in 2020 from a 4.6 percent growth in the previous year. The top contributors to the decline were Manufacturing, which dropped by 11.6 percent; Construction at -36.0 percent; and Real estate and…

The Consumer Price Index (CPI) measures the changes in the price level of goods and services that most people buy for their day-to-day consumption. It is most widely used in the calculation of the inflation rate and purchasing power of the peso.
A total of 3,182 live births were registered in the province in January 2021. It recorded a decrease of 3.6 percent from the December 2020 figure of 3,301.
